Re: *All* characters make mistakes
Unexpected: He should have asked more questions about that electrical thing that happened when Ahlen touched him. Breaking the Ice: He should have minded his own business about T'Pol's letter; she would have married Koss before Trip had a chance to fall in love with her and think of the grief he could have been spared: no sexperimental lab rat; he wouldn't have to watch T'Pol marry Koss anyway; he wouldn't have to watch baby Elizabeth die... Desert Crossing: Letting Archer talk him into going to the desert planet. He damn near died. Two Days and Two Nights: He really shouldn't have fallen for the old "garden in a basement" line. Dead Stop: He shouldn't have gone exploring on the repair station. "Precious" Cargo: He should have left the princess in the box. Stigma: He should have introduced Feezal to Reed. Cogenitor: He should have learned more about the attitudes of the Vissians before even thinking about approaching Charles. The Expanse: He should gone to see his family when he got home. It might have helped him to grieve and spared us that stupid VNP crap. Twilight: He should have listened to Phlox and T'Pol when they tried to tell him that they had found the reset button. Harbinger: He shouldn't have been doing VNP with Cole. It really ticked me off. E2: He never asked about T'Pold. Home: He didn't stop T'Pol from marrying Koss. Demons/Terra Prime: No effort at all to disguise himself or T'Pol. The TP'ers clearly knew who they were, so what made them think they wouldn't be recognized?! These Ain't The Voyages: He shouldn't have shown up on the set.

Re: *All* characters make mistakes
*Withholding the cure in "Dear Doctor." *Telling the Klingons about Trip's "problem" while on the bridge in "Unexpected." I know it was scripted like that for laughs, but - how humiliating! He should have just referenced some life-or-death problem and not made Trip lift his shirt in full view. I agree with Lady C on Archer's not noticing T'Pol's addiction. By that time in the season, everyone was acting screwy, and she gave him a perfectly reasonable explanation in The Towel Scene: she hadn't had time to meditate. He already knew that nightly meditation was a necessity for Vulcans: the dialogue in Fusion established that ("You meditate every night?" "Yes." "I think I understand why now"). Her behaviour wasn't so extreme that he'd associate it with the Trellium exposure he'd seen in Impulse.
